  • Title

    Application of Lyapunov stability criterion to determine the control strategy of a STATCOM

  • Abstract
    While the primary purpose of a STATCOM is to support busbar voltage by injecting appropriate reactive power, it can also improve the dynamic behaviour of a power system. The paper proposes a control strategy of a STATCOM to improve the stability of a power system which is derived from the stability criterion of Lyapunov´s second or direct method. The proposed control strategy of the STATCOM was then tested on a single-machine infinitebusbar system and the IEEE 20-machine test system. It was found that the proposed control strategy of a STATCOM could significantly enlarge the stability region and, hence, stability of a power system. The effect of STATCOM rating on system stability is also investigated.
